The video tutorial explains how to find the oxidation numbers for Fe3O4 using specific rules. It highlights the unique case of Fe3O4, where a fractional oxidation number is encountered. The tutorial covers the oxidation states of oxygen and iron, emphasizing that oxygen typically has a -2 oxidation number. It explains the concept of a neutral compound and sets up an equation to determine the oxidation number of iron in Fe3O4. The solution reveals that each iron atom has an oxidation number of eight over three. The video concludes by verifying the calculations and confirming the neutrality of the compound.
